Output 7520f94245718415b6b78509feec4d61e440de2d57340654c3fdc55c3f357b89:0

value
2074500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09ec41668a01be91d78cdae33b4aff2081a5e74c OP_EQUAL
address
M8odLUUfb99shvKWWPSGiRRFWBYtBEE5yS
transaction
7520f94245718415b6b78509feec4d61e440de2d57340654c3fdc55c3f357b89
spent
true